Why these dates

If your frost-free season is shorter than 110 days, start indoors and choose a smaller cultivar. Giant pumpkins are a long-season crop, not a beginner one.

Foliage dies at the first frost, but mature fruit tolerates a light touch. Harvest before a hard frost or the flesh will not store.

Seed packets and extension guides express timing as weeks either side of the last spring frost, because that is the only reference point that travels. Pumpkins are timed from 3 weeks before that frost for an indoor start, with planting out 2 weeks after it, and this page simply resolves those offsets against the frost date computed for Colina.

The median frost-free season here is 249 days, against 90 to 120 days to maturity for this crop counted from sowing. That margin is what decides whether a late sowing is worth attempting.

Growing pumpkins in Colina

When should I plant pumpkins in Colina?

Aim for 11-25 Oct in an average year. If you would rather not gamble on the weather, wait until 2-16 Nov - by then frost has finished in nine years out of ten.

When will pumpkins be ready to harvest in Colina?

Expect to start picking around 9 Jan - 8 Feb, based on 90 to 120 days to maturity from the planting date calculated for this location.

How much frost will pumpkins tolerate?

Foliage dies at the first frost, but mature fruit tolerates a light touch. Harvest before a hard frost or the flesh will not store.
